What is remote AI data collection?

Remote AI data collection refers to the process of gathering and labeling data—such as images, audio, text, or video—from various sources using digital tools, often from a remote location. This data is used to train and improve artificial intelligence and machine learning models. People working in this field can perform tasks like annotating images, transcribing audio, or categorizing text, all from their home or another remote setting. The work is essential for creating accurate AI systems and often offers flexible hours. It usually requires basic computer skills and attention to detail.

What skills and qualifications are needed for a remote AI data collection specialist?

To thrive as a Remote AI Data Collection Specialist, you need attention to detail, data management skills, and a basic understanding of machine learning concepts, often supported by a degree in computer science or related fields. Familiarity with data annotation tools, spreadsheets, and platforms like Labelbox or Amazon SageMaker is commonly required. Strong communication, time management, and problem-solving skills are important for collaborating remotely and meeting project deadlines. These abilities ensure accurate, efficient data gathering and annotation, which are critical for the quality and reliability of AI model development.

What are common challenges in a remote AI data collection role, and how can they be managed?

A common challenge in Remote AI Data Collection roles is ensuring data quality and consistency, especially when working independently without direct supervision. It is important to follow detailed guidelines precisely and communicate proactively with project managers or team leads whenever uncertainties arise. Time management and maintaining motivation can also be challenging when working remotely, so setting a structured schedule and leveraging collaboration tools can help. Regular check-ins with the team and staying updated with project requirements are key to overcoming these challenges and delivering reliable results.

Senior Software Engineer

Job Type: Contractor (~15 hours/week)
Location: Remote

Job Summary

We are seeking experienced Senior Software Engineers to support an AI training project by creating reinforcement learning environments that evaluate AI models on complex software engineering tasks using Model Context Protocol (MCP) tools.

You will design reproducible environments, deterministic verification, and reference solutions for tasks such as bug fixing, feature implementation, codebase refactoring, and performance optimization. No prior AI experience is required.

Key Responsibilities
  • Create reinforcement learning environments for software engineering tasks.
  • Design tasks involving bug fixing, feature development, refactoring, and performance optimization.
  • Build deterministic verification systems and golden reference solutions.
  • Evaluate AI agents' ability to reason through complex codebases and use MCP tools effectively.
  • Develop realistic, reproducible software engineering scenarios.
  • Ensure tasks accurately measure coding ability, problem-solving, and tool usage.
  • Document solutions and provide clear technical feedback.
